| # Reproducibility package |
|
|
| This directory reproduces the empirical claims in Sections 3 and 4 of the |
| paper. It is intentionally separate from `../paper`: the paper is a readable |
| article, while this directory fixes executable objects, parameters and result |
| artifacts. |
|
|
| ## Frozen corpus |
|
|
| | component | value | |
| |---|---| |
| | Mathlib release | `v4.33.0` | |
| | Mathlib commit | `db584cd6d46c92f209a44c0f1c829460d327499d` | |
| | Lean toolchain | `leanprover/lean4:v4.33.0` | |
| | Raw schema | `mesomath-corpus-v2` | |
| | set.mm commit | `057f4c461055d0b1ed78d9d333aa3de34d9771fa` | |
|
|
| The tag is descriptive; the full commit is authoritative. |
|
|
| ## Paper claims and experiment IDs |
|
|
| | ID | Paper claim | Inputs | Result artifact | |
| |---|---|---|---| |
| | `S3.1-depth-growth` | theorem graph is deep and sparse | primary theorem view | `results/S3.1-depth-growth.json` | |
| | `S3.2-namespace-depth` | namespace depths differ by over an order of magnitude | primary theorem view | `results/S3.2-namespace-depth.json` | |
| | `S3.3-compression-reuse` | proof-term/statement ratio is associated with reuse | primary theorem view | `results/S3.3-compression-reuse.json` | |
| | `S3.4-projection-geometry` | measurements depend on projection, but detected geometry lies within degree-preserving nulls | primary theorem hypergraph | `results/S3.4-projection-geometry.json` | |
| | `S3.4-metamath` | depth growth is similar across libraries but compression--reuse is not | Mathlib primary view and pinned `set.mm` | `results/S3.4-metamath.json` | |
| | `S4.1-navigation` | structure ranks a reviewed target above random | v4.33 declaration view and reviewed labels | `results/S4.1-navigation.json` | |
|
|
| `claims.json` is the machine-readable version of this table. A result is not |
| ready to enter the paper until it records the corpus manifest hash, analysis |
| configuration and random seed where relevant. Sections 3 and 4 have been |
| rerun on v4.33.0. Section 4's exact historical inputs remain as a regression |
| fixture, while the paper result uses the reviewed current statements and a |
| graph built entirely from the pinned v4.33.0 export. |

| ## Layout |
|
|
| ```text |
| experiments/ |
| claims.json claim-to-artifact registry |
| spec/ exact mathematical and computational objects |
| LEGACY_AUDIT.md claim-by-claim audit of the old implementation |
| legacy/ small immutable regression fixtures from old runs |
| lean/ native Mathlib environment extractor |
| analysis/ statistical analysis and figure generation |
| labels/ reviewed external labels (for Section 4) |
| data/raw/ Lean exports; generated, not committed |
| data/derived/ declared graph views; generated, not committed |
| results/ reviewed machine-readable result manifests |
| ``` |

| ## Reproduction stages |
|
|
| 1. Build and test the native extractor: |
|
|
| ```sh |
| cd lean |
| lake update |
| lake exe cache get |
| lake build |
| lake exe meso-extractor-tests |
| ``` |
|
|
| 2. Export the Mathlib corpus: |
|
|
| ```sh |
| lake exe meso-extract --out ../data/raw/mathlib-v4.33.0 |
| ``` |
|
|
| A fast format smoke test may import one module explicitly; this is never a |
| substitute for the full command above: |
|
|
| ```sh |
| lake exe meso-extract \ |
| --out /tmp/mesomath-smoke \ |
| --import-module Mathlib.Data.Nat.ModEq \ |
| --module-prefix Mathlib.Data.Nat.ModEq \ |
| --limit 25 |
| ``` |
|
|
| 3. Materialize the paper's graph views and run analyses: |
|
|
| ```sh |
| cd ../analysis |
| uv run pytest |
| uv run mesomath-analysis views \ |
| ../data/raw/mathlib-v4.33.0 ../data/derived/mathlib-v4.33.0 |
| uv run mesomath-analysis run-s3 \ |
| ../data/derived/mathlib-v4.33.0/primary-theorem-hypergraph.json \ |
| ../results |
| uv run mesomath-analysis run-geometry \ |
| ../data/derived/mathlib-v4.33.0/primary-theorem-hypergraph.json \ |
| ../results/S3.4-projection-geometry.json |
| ``` |
|
|
| The `views` command writes both the primary auto/private-filtered theorem |
| hypergraph and an internal-name-only sensitivity view matching the legacy |
| filter. Section 3 commands use the primary file unless explicitly pointed |
| at the sensitivity file. |
|
|
| 4. Clone the exact Metamath Proof Explorer snapshot and run the independent |
| cross-library adapter: |
|
|
| ```sh |
| git clone https://github.com/metamath/set.mm ../data/raw/set.mm |
| git -C ../data/raw/set.mm checkout 057f4c461055d0b1ed78d9d333aa3de34d9771fa |
| uv run mesomath-analysis run-metamath \ |
| ../data/raw/set.mm ../results/S3.4-metamath.json \ |
| --revision 057f4c461055d0b1ed78d9d333aa3de34d9771fa \ |
| --mathlib-depth-result ../results/S3.1-depth-growth.json \ |
| --mathlib-compression-result ../results/S3.3-compression-reuse.json |
| ``` |
|
|
| The parser's theorem count and selected reuse/proof-size values were |
| cross-checked against the official C verifier; the exact audit is recorded |
| in `verification/metamath-official-verifier.md`. |
|
|
| 5. Run the reviewed v4.33 declaration-graph experiment: |
|
|
| ```sh |
| uv run mesomath-analysis run-navigation \ |
| ../data/raw/mathlib-v4.33.0 \ |
| ../labels/ahlfors_positive_declarations_v4.33-review.csv \ |
| ../results/S4.1-navigation.json |
| ``` |
|
|
| A complete second run produced a byte-identical result file (SHA-256 |
| `76c7510f933daa39b0ae2ba42bd8e1d1728c481948bf03811a4e40aed4a2e9f3`). |
|
|
| The full-corpus commands are deliberately separate from unit tests: importing |
| and traversing all of Mathlib is an experiment run, not a build step. |
